What type of funds do I require for a composer?
Expenses for composers functioning on your film can fluctuate from $five,000 to $one hundred,000+ relying on your songs demands. Present business normal is to have ten% of your movie funds devoted to audio licensing to contain licensing existing audio as well as obtaining new tunes composed. A single item that decides the cost will be the acceptance and good results of the tunes or composer that you’ve selected. The decrease amounts of $5,000 may get you a laptop created composition which will have a different audio and sensation as that of a stay orchestrated piece that can cost you tens of 1000’s of dollars. Do not anxiety too significantly as technology is ever more making it less difficult to synthesize dwell instruments and drive down the value to rating a total feature – assuming you will not thoughts making use of electronic tracks versus stay musicians and instruments. $20,000 to $30,000 can get you some wonderful scores with stay instruments and musicians assuming there are no problems or modifications needed. Always remember that you have to approve the last songs “cues” before sending it off to get recorded dwell, otherwise, it can grow to be costly if you commence requiring tunes rewrites following last recording. Most key studio movies fall in the realm of $twenty five,000 to $50,000 for composer costs. It is possible to shell out a handful of songwriters tiny fee’s ($two,five hundred to $five,000) to create digital compositions and then proceed with the total fee if you choose to use that songs.
What kind of licensing possibilities ought to I demand?
Do you actually want to own all the legal rights to the tunes in your movie? www.dbsfilms.com get confused over licensing when employing a composer and might scare off the good ones if they start demanding as well several rights to the composer’s tunes. The simple products you will require will be a sync license to use the music in your movie. You ought to also take into account language in the license that permits use of the track in sequels, prequels, movie advertising and marketing, trailers, and co-promotions. Publishing is a large negotiable merchandise when discussing composition of audio for a movie. Taking 100% of the publishing will be having a whole lot of funds away from the songwriter from potential royalties and will increase your original charge. Making it possible for the songwriter to preserve twenty five% to one hundred% of the tunes publishing rights will let you to negotiate a decrease charge for use of the composition in your movie. One more product to think about is exclusive rights as opposed to non-distinctive legal rights to the music. Exclusive legal rights will only enable the songs to be certified to you and your movie but will cost a lot more. Some tiny budget movies will license the composition non-distinctive for a modest payment but permit the composer to hold all the rights to the audio. As constantly it is greatest to seek the advice of a lawyer to make sure you protect the very best possibilities for your film composition licensing.
Do I have to pay out songwriter royalties in the potential?
All songwriters are entitled to receive efficiency royalties when their audio is performed publicly these kinds of as in a restaurant, on the radio, or on tv. Movies even so, have someway avoided paying out overall performance royalties in the United States even even though theaters are about as general public as you can get. Songwriters WILL be compensated for their songs performed in videos abroad from those country’s overall performance legal rights organizations. No need to fret although as U.S. film studios will not have to pay these royalties. Functionality royalties are paid for by the venue actively playing the music, regardless of whether a significant television network exhibiting the movie or a small cafe enjoying the soundtrack. These venues will spend the 3 performance rights organizations an annual fee to engage in all the music in their respective catalogs, and the rights companies then pay the songwriters. It is essential nevertheless, as a filmmaker, to properly file what are named cue sheets to the functionality rights businesses. This allows them know the songwriters and composers that worked on your movie and how you provided their songs. This guarantees that your composers are paid effectively in the future.
